It is an effort to introduce the world of stories to the children; where they can meet the Baghiras and Mowglis of the world and expand the horizon of their imagination with the stories from Panchatantra, Hitopadesha, Jataka.

 

The workshop is intended to introduce "fables of India" to the children. Here are the things we will cover: 

 

 

1. Introduction to the concept - Fables of India. 

2. Difference between fables, fairy tales, and folk tales 

3. Elements of a good story.

4. Storytelling using gestures. 

5. Children will be guided in becoming storytellers themselves. 

 

They will not only enjoy but learn the important lessons of life.
